In Focus with Carolyn Hutcheson
Join the conversation each weekday on ”In Focus” as host Carolyn Hutcheson talks with: artists, historians, experts, environmentalists, musicians, authors, and other big thinkers and change makers. Carolyn brings her three decades of on-air experience, her curious mind, and her warm conversational style to each episode. We hope you join us and take time to bring your world, In Focus.

On August 24, 2021, Meredith Eberhart, whose trail nameis Nimblewill Nomad, became the oldest person at age 83to hike the Appalachian Trail, which stretches from Maineto Georgia. In Focus brings you his interview atop FlaggMountain, as the crowd welcomed him home.
